Durham
City Ladies FC returned to winning ways with an excellent
3-2 victory away to Penrith. This result puts the team in a
strong position to reach the final of the Second Division
Cup. Durham play Penrith in the return leg at home on Sunday
15 April at Laurel Avenue Primary School, Sherburn Road -
2pm KO.

Durham started well with Amanda
Smith scoring from close range after a Magda Carr cross.
Although Durham had started well, Penrith scored two goals
in a five minute spell. Cath Beck scored a tap in for
Penrith after the ball had dropped to her off the cross bar.
City's Linda Machell then was unfortunate to score an own
goal after a misunderstanding with 'keeper Korraine Boughen.
Durham then dug deep and
equalised before half time. As the result of some further
excellent play by Carr on the wing the ball dropped to Helen
Richardson in front of goal. The striker scored her 37th
goal of the season by blasting the ball home.

Helen Richardson then
won the game for Durham with a second half goal which the
Penrith goalkeeper could not hold.
City Manager, Stephen Hamil,
chose to praise two of the players, "Magda Carr and
Claire Turner have been excellent recently. Magda does some
really unselfish work up front and sets up a number of our
goals. At the other end of the pitch Claire reads the game
really well and plays some nice football out of defence".
